mysql - 如何删除多个空字段
问题描述
我正在尝试删除所有具有空值的字段,但我没有得到它,我尝试过这种方式但它不起作用。
DELETE FROM ctuser WHERE (SELECT *FROM ctuser WHERE nome = '')
;
解决方案
试试这个:
DELETE FROM ctuser WHERE nome = '' OR nome IS NULL;
推荐阅读
- mysql - 操作数应在我的 sql 查询中包含 1 列错误
- html - 语义 HTML 和 BEM CSS
- c++ - 在 Visual Studio Code 中运行代码时出现问题
- javascript - 如何使用 PHP 在 Google 表格图表中排序日期?
- numpy - 如何使用 Matplotlib 或其他在动画图中绘制不规则采样的时间数据?
- vim - 当我在vim中时,如何在光标下路径的位置打开一个shell?
- scala - if和elseif中的scala多个条件
- asp.net-core - 使用数据库上下文的依赖注入。如何在普通类中获取数据库上下文
- ember.js - Ember 插件中的 Pod 结构
- javascript - Node.js 中 ES6 模块的内联导入